Hi People,

I have just fitted a new regulator on the drivers side of my 08'Superb.

The motor appeared to be functioning prior to change, however, after change and reassembly I do not have power at the master switch anymore and also the "remote central locking unit" has stopped working, the central locking does work manually. Just wondering if anyone has had this problem and may have a quick solution. I have checked the fuzes and all appear fine. Thanks for any help or advice.

make sure the plugs are pushed into the motor tightly its usually the last plug to control all the power

And now you've had the carrier panel off the car you will almost certainly develop a water leak into the cabin.  You might want to seal it up before you wake up to the puddles in the footwell...! :)  Tixophalte on the outside of the carrier, where it meets the door panel, works well and can be removed easily should you need to get in there again.
